2015-04-19 2 views
7

Calling logInWithReadPermissionsInBackground всегда возвращает нуль пользователя и неверной датуParseFacebookUtils [V4-1.9.1] logInWithReadPermissionsInBackground неверной даты

com.parse.ParseRequest$ParseRequestException: Invalid date 

Я использую ParseFacebookUtils [V4-1.9.1]

вот мой код

private void onLoginUserClicked() 
{ 
    final List<String> permissions = new ArrayList<String>(); 
    permissions.add("public_profile"); 
    permissions.add("user_status"); 
    permissions.add("user_friends"); 

    ParseFacebookUtils.logInWithReadPermissionsInBackground(LoginActivity.this, permissions, new LogInCallback() { 
     @Override 
     public void done(ParseUser user, ParseException err) { 
      if (user == null) { 
       Log.d("MyApp", "Error: "+err); 
      } else 
      { 
       if (user.isNew()) { 
        Log.d("MyApp", "User signed up and logged in through Facebook!"); 
       } else { 
        Log.d("MyApp", "User logged in through Facebook!"); 

       } 
      } 
     } 
    }); 
} 

ничего нормального я не могу преодолеть эту проблему, если вам поможет?

+0

правильно установлена ​​дата на устройстве? – Cristik

+0

Да автоматически – nmortada

+0

@nmortada У вас все еще есть эта проблема? –

ответ

2

У меня был вопрос о моделировании.

я пропустил этот Methode:

@Override 
protected void onActivityResult(int requestCode, int resultCode, Intent data) { 
    super.onActivityResult(requestCode, resultCode, data); 
    ParseFacebookUtils.onActivityResult(requestCode, resultCode, data); 
}